Volunteers like you are essential to providing food for Oklahomans living with hunger
Through this on-site volunteer experience, volunteers like you sort, pack and prepare food for a variety of Regional Food Bank Programs. Activities may include:
- Assembling sacks of nutritious food for the Food for Kids Backpack Program
- Packing Commodity Supplemental Food Program boxes full of food for seniors living on fixed incomes
- Sorting and packing bread, produce, package meals and/or cans
- Tagging bags
- Cleaning
Because the Regional Food Bank's inventory changes daily, the Regional Food Bank cannot guarantee volunteers who sign up to work in the Volunteer Center will pack and prepare food for a specific program.
Volunteers must be at least 8 years old to volunteer for this project. Volunteers under the age of 16 must be accompanied by an adult.
